Can you smell the fried food and cotton candy? Fair season is upon us, and amusement rides are usually just part of the whole fair-going experience. The modern fair has roots in ancient times, tracing back to a variety of influences, from Roman religious festivals to temporary markets set up at crossroads along the trade routes from Asia to Europe. Today, county and state fairs often combine industry and agriculture exhibits with various entertainment options such as this swing ride. What’s your fair-season favorite?
